An electric bike burst into flames in the street in Salford on Tuesday evening (August 15). Fire crews closed off part of Hamilton Street and Douglas Street after they were called out to the incident.
Dramatic pictures shared by Pendleton ward councillor John Warmisham showed the moment the e-bike erupted into flames outside a house at around 6pm as locals watched on.
Official guidance from the National Fire Chiefs Council says that electric bikes and scooters, which are becoming more popular, typically use lithium batteries which are now resulting in an increasing number of fires.

Coun Warmisham tweeted pictures of the fire, writing: "Scary the way this electric bike just burst into flames outside my daughters. Thankfully no one was hurt."
A spokesperson for the Greater Manchester Fire and Rescue Service said: “At around 6pm this evening (Tuesday August 15), one fire engine from Broughton fire station was called to reports of a fire involving an electric bike on Douglas Street, Salford.
“The crew arrived quickly at the scene. Firefighters wearing breathing apparatus used a hose reel, thermal imaging camera and gas detector to extinguish the fire and make the area safe. Firefighters were in attendance for around an hour and a half.”
